Most Profitable Coins To Mine With AMD Radeon Vega 56

Radeon RX Vega 56 is a graphics card of the high-end AMD series. It was announced in August 2017 along with RX Vega 64 and RX Vega 64 Liquid. According to benchmarks, its performance is comparable to that of GTX 1070 and 1070 Ti. On Ethash algorithm it gives out 50% more than RX 570 and RX 580.

The RX Vega 56 owners point out high power consumption. Plus, some complain that its case tends to overheat. Apart from that, there is nothing to complain about. It's a great graphics card with decent specs.

AMD Radeon Vega 56 Mining Hashrate

Cuckatoo31
1.15 Gps
Cuckatoo32
0.42 Gps
Equihash
450 Sol/s
BeamHash
30 Sol/s
Ethash
53 Mh/s
Etchash
53 Mh/s
KAWPOW
25 Mh/s
Autolykos2
140.5 Mh/s
KHeavyHash
0.297 Gh/s
NexaPow
36.6 Mh/s

AMD Radeon Vega 56 Overclocking for Mining

To maximize hash rate you are probably going to need to configure additional settings. First, make sure that the GPU driver you are using supports mining. You might also need an upgrade in case you have AMD GPUs. Next step is to choose an optimal GPU overclocking value to maximize hash rate and keep energy consumption at an acceptable level. Algorithms may require core overclocking, memory overclocking, or both. The main overclocking principle is stable work and maximum hash rate at an acceptable energy consumption level. It’s important to remember that each GPU is unique. If for one it is possible to overclock the core to 2000 MHz, for a similar one you may be able to overclock only to 1900 MHz.
